summaryrefslogtreecommitdiff
path: root/tests/test_utils/tests.py
diff options
context:
space:
mode:
authorJon Dufresne <jon.dufresne@gmail.com>2019-05-09 08:17:42 -0700
committerCarlton Gibson <carlton.gibson@noumenal.es>2019-05-09 17:17:42 +0200
commitde6d3afb97454e0653d55adadcf0df7e2a03c088 (patch)
tree57b2127cd1617020e8793e7be81b3d7f5ae7e58a /tests/test_utils/tests.py
parente2feea5fc4e55ddf92a16fc4990d877feb963e80 (diff)
Refs #27804 -- Used subTest() in HTMLEqualTests.test_self_closing_tags.
Diffstat (limited to 'tests/test_utils/tests.py')
-rw-r--r--tests/test_utils/tests.py21
1 files changed, 11 insertions, 10 deletions
diff --git a/tests/test_utils/tests.py b/tests/test_utils/tests.py
index 5b84bbd383..c14746f344 100644
--- a/tests/test_utils/tests.py
+++ b/tests/test_utils/tests.py
@@ -542,17 +542,18 @@ class HTMLEqualTests(SimpleTestCase):
'base', 'col',
)
for tag in self_closing_tags:
- dom = parse_html('<p>Hello <%s> world</p>' % tag)
- self.assertEqual(len(dom.children), 3)
- self.assertEqual(dom[0], 'Hello')
- self.assertEqual(dom[1].name, tag)
- self.assertEqual(dom[2], 'world')
+ with self.subTest(tag):
+ dom = parse_html('<p>Hello <%s> world</p>' % tag)
+ self.assertEqual(len(dom.children), 3)
+ self.assertEqual(dom[0], 'Hello')
+ self.assertEqual(dom[1].name, tag)
+ self.assertEqual(dom[2], 'world')
- dom = parse_html('<p>Hello <%s /> world</p>' % tag)
- self.assertEqual(len(dom.children), 3)
- self.assertEqual(dom[0], 'Hello')
- self.assertEqual(dom[1].name, tag)
- self.assertEqual(dom[2], 'world')
+ dom = parse_html('<p>Hello <%s /> world</p>' % tag)
+ self.assertEqual(len(dom.children), 3)
+ self.assertEqual(dom[0], 'Hello')
+ self.assertEqual(dom[1].name, tag)
+ self.assertEqual(dom[2], 'world')
def test_simple_equal_html(self):
self.assertHTMLEqual('', '')